See you later, Mr. Shrek!

Well, the epic about great and terrible ogre has ended. Yes, quite a few years he has been giving us joy. And after the third part it seemed to have nothing more to shoot. History is told through. But no, the creators still managed to surprise us.

This time the story cartoon based on a simple truth: "We never know the value of water till the well is dry. Yes, Shrek tired of family life, and he was again waiting for adventure. If he can't find them easily, he decided to sign a contract and to recover his youth, at least for a day".

Perhaps, in comparison with the first part, the film is not entertaining, but still worth a look, if only to say goodbye to the green giant and his company.

And the company, as always, do not let us down! The donkey and the cat have always aroused my affection. Perhaps, as compared with the younger film enthusiasts, I am not so enraptured by cartoons, but still from the cinema I went in high spirits.

The last part seemed to me the most serious of all. There are also a lot of amusing and funny moments, but if by the way affected family values and all that should be for everyone: love, friendship, understanding, assistance and support of the best friends. We saw Fiona us a woman-warrior (first time it is possible to see with new eyes - before we knew her as exemplary wife and loving mother) and finally, Shrek, trying to reclaim their lives , idealistic and happy with his kids and loved wife in a cozy house on the marsh.

The film won the best of fun, vivid and instructive. Shrek had his midlife crisis. Investigate the problem and again began to live happily together with the cookies, pigs and other inhabitants of the magic forest.

First of all I will say that caught my eye cartoon graphic. Technology does not stand still and Shrek cartoon was very bright and beautiful. And so fashionable now, 3D was looked simply magical! Young children will especially delight furry donkey and plumped Puss in Boots!

Of course, it's a pity that this is the end. After all, we would like to know what happens with Shrek in old age. Innit?
